We may partner with ad networks and other ad serving providers (“Advertising Providers”) that serve ads on behalf of us and others on non-affiliated platforms.  Some of those ads may be personalized, meaning that they are intended to be relevant to you based on information Advertising Providers collect about your use of the Site and other sites or apps over time, including information about relationships among different browsers and devices.  This type of advertising is known as interest-based advertising.

You may visit the DAA WebChoices tool at www.aboutads.info/choices  to learn more about this type of advertising and how to opt out of this advertising on websites by companies participating in the DAA self-regulatory program.  Additionally, you can visit www.aboutads.info/appchoices to download the DAA’s AppChoices tool for your mobile device to opt-out of interest-based advertising for your mobile device. 

If you delete your cookies, reset your identifier, or use a different browser or mobile device, you may need to renew your opt-out choices exercised through the DAA’s tools or make choices through those other browsers or devices.  Note that electing to opt out will not stop advertising from appearing in your browser or applications.  It may make the ads you see less relevant to your interests.

California Civil Code Section 1798.83 (also known as the “Shine The Light” law) permits users who are California residents to request and obtain from us once a year, free of charge, information about the Personal Information (if any) we disclosed to third parties for direct marketing purposes in the preceding calendar year.
